SPARC, which stands for the Scholarly Publishing and Academic Resources Coalition, is a global advocate for open access to research and education. Its mission is to make sure that academic knowledge is available to everyone — not locked behind expensive paywalls that most people cannot afford. Personal Life and Privacy
Heather Carmillia Joseph is in a relationship with Dr. Amsu Anpu, a highly skilled endocrinologist and British expatriate. Despite being associated with fame due to her son, Heather prefers to keep her personal life away from the spotlight.
Her previous relationship with Kevin Cornelius Emmons brought her son Shéyaa into the world. Together, they had a son named Shéyaa Bin Abraham-Joseph, who was born on October 22, 1992. Today, the world knows him as the rapper 21 Savage. After separating from Kevin, Heather made a big decision. She moved to Atlanta, Georgia with her young son.
Heather Carmillia Joseph’s life has also been marked by profound personal loss. Despite this grief, Heather continued to function as a stabilizing force for her remaining family. Loss did not harden her; instead, it deepened her emotional resilience. She lost two sons. Her son Quantivayus, also known as Tayman, was shot and killed in 2016 during a drug deal. Her other son Terrell, known as TM1Way, was stabbed in South London on November 22, 2020. These losses are difficult to put into words, and Heather has faced them with a kind of quiet courage that earns the deepest respect.

Siblings and Children
Heather’s role as a mother has been central to her life story. She single-handedly raised her son, Sheyaa Bin Abraham-Joseph, known to the world as 21 Savage, in Atlanta, Georgia.
Heather is also mother to twin daughters Kyra and Jayda, both of whom established themselves professionally in choreography and the performing arts. Both daughters live in London and work as choreographers. They have built successful careers in dance and have many followers on YouTube under the name “The Davis Twins.”
